Text excerpt by Alien Transistor:

"Alien Transistor is proud to announce a reissue of Such December, the fourth album by Japanese indie folk-pop artist, Gratin Carnival. Listeners might already know Gratin Carnival from their appearance on the Alien Parade Japan compilation of indie pop groups working with brass and woodwind ; compiled by Markus Acher of The Notwist and Saya of Tenniscoats, it introduced this beautiful genre to the wider world. Gratin Carnival's “Just Watching” was one of the many highlights of that compilation, and its gentle bossa-folk glide reappears on Such December.

Originally released in 2020, Such December captures beautifully the happy-sad charm of Gratin Carnival. The project of Koreyuki Mitsunaga, Gratin Carnival started in 2011; Mitsunaga had been home recording for some time and decided on the name as an umbrella for his music- making. Mitsunaga's main instruments are guitar, which he uses to great effect throughout, his gorgeous acoustic playing reminiscent of players like Ueno Takashi of Tenniscoats or João Gilberto, and alto saxophone and clarinet. Those three instruments make up the core of Gratin Carnival's sound, along with Mitsunaga's charmingly doleful singing.

Recording at his parents' home, with a four-track cassette recorder and a MacBook, Mitsunaga created Such December during 2020, though the songs on it stretch back to 2016. The closing “On The Train” was the first song written for the album – “a song about a small trip,” Mitsunaga recalls – and from there, he built a beautiful collection of songs that sit together perfectly. There's great clarity in Mitsunaga's writing, with nothing extraneous getting in the way of the lucid arrangements and gorgeous melodies there's something of chamber jazz about it at times, so it's no surprise that Mitsunaga shares his love of Benny Goodman's small group playing."
